Start with the project's purpose: load-bearing surfaces like driveways need harder, well-graded base material while decorative beds need a clean, uniform finish. Consider drainage, local climate (hot, dry, and sometimes windy in West Kansas), and appearance preferences. Measure the area (length x width) and decide on the depth you need; then use a material calculator to convert to cubic yards or tons. As a rule of thumb, 1 cubic yard of typical aggregate weighs roughly 1.2 to 1.6 tons depending on material and moisture. Yes. Truck access, overhead lines, narrow streets, steep driveways, and weight limits can restrict where a driver can drop material. Clear the intended drop zone, remove obstacles, and mark it clearly for the driver. Discuss access and staging notes at checkout so suppliers can plan the safest drop.
Small landscape deliveries usually do not require a permit, but driveway replacement, curb cuts, or work that affects public right-of-way often do. Permit rules vary by city and county, so check with the City of Allen or the local county public works before you begin. If a permit is required, plan extra time for approvals when scheduling delivery.
Hot, dry, and windy conditions common to West Kansas increase dust and can make lightweight materials blow, so plan for wind control and compaction. Dry conditions can make some materials looser and harder to compact, while seasonal rains can change delivery and work timing. Choose materials and installation timing that match local conditions to reduce settling and erosion issues.

Clear trees, vehicles, and obstacles from the drop area and create a firm, level surface for the truck when possible. Mark the exact drop point with flags or cones and protect nearby landscaping or paved areas with plywood if needed. Slope, native soil type, and drainage patterns determine whether you need additional base material, geotextile fabric, or specific aggregate gradation for stability. Poorly draining soils may need coarser base material and better grading to move water away from structures. If your site has steep slopes or heavy clay, consider consulting our team or a local contractor for a layered approach that improves drainage and long-term performance.
